"Really disappointed with the service."

About: Northwick Park Hospital / Accident and emergency

I had a relative that was extremely dizzy and so they were taken to a and e. They arrived there mid day and were given a bed early next morning. It took them 2 days to perform a scan. We were all worried for two days on what was wrong but people would not tell us. They would say either vertigo or stroke but were not sure until the actual scan happened. I am really disappointed with this service. My relative was walking funny for 2 days so we were all worried. I am not a doctor or in a medical related profession and so it would have been extremely useful to us if someone would inform us on the situation or what was going on. That way we could be less worried. Really disappointed on the way things were managed. We just wanted better communication.
